Anime isn't a genre; it's a medium. Inside that medium, there are dozens of sub-genres.

Demographics

  • Shonen: Young boys (Action, Adventure). Example: Naruto.
  • Shojo: Young girls (Romance, Drama). Example: Fruits Basket.
  • Seinen: Adult men (Darker, Psychological). Example: Berserk.
  • Josei: Adult women (Realistic Romance). Example: Nana.

Genres

  • Isekai: "Another World." Protagonist gets transported to a fantasy world.
  • Slice of Life: Mundane, everyday life. Relaxing and wholesome.
  • Mecha: Giant robots.
